What Is Covered Under Parallel Computing Market?

Parallel computing refers to the simultaneous execution of multiple computational processes across multi-core processors, graphics processing units (GPUs), clusters, or distributed computing architectures to accelerate data processing, improve performance, and optimize computational efficiency. It enables organizations to solve complex tasks such as simulations, machine learning workloads, scientific modeling, and big data analysis by dividing operations into smaller tasks processed concurrently. It enhances scalability, reduces processing time, and supports high-performance computing (HPC) applications across scientific, industrial, and commercial environments. The main components in parallel computing include hardware, software, and services. Hardware is widely used, as it provides the multi-core processors, accelerators, and high-speed interconnects required to execute multiple computations simultaneously and improve processing throughput. Parallel computing solutions are deployed through on-premises and cloud models and are adopted by small and medium enterprises as well as large enterprises. They are applied across scientific research and modeling, artificial intelligence and machine learning, high-performance data analytics, engineering and simulation, media, entertainment, and rendering, and others, serving end-users in information technology and telecommunications, banking, financial services, and insurance, healthcare, manufacturing, government, and others.

What Is The Parallel Computing Market Size and Share 2026?

The parallel computing market size has grown rapidly in recent years. It will grow from $41.31 billion in 2025 to $47.31 billion in 2026 at a compound annual growth rate (CAGR) of 14.5%. The growth in the historic period can be attributed to increasing adoption of multi-core processors, growing demand for scientific simulations, rising use of graphics processing units (GPUs)-accelerated computing, expanding big data processing requirements, and increasing reliance on high-performance computing in research.

What Is The Parallel Computing Market Growth Forecast?

The parallel computing market size is expected to see rapid growth in the next few years. It will grow to $80.55 billion in 2030 at a compound annual growth rate (CAGR) of 14.2%. The growth in the forecast period can be attributed to the growing deployment of cloud-based high-performance computing (HPC) solutions, increasing demand for parallel processing in artificial intelligence workloads, rising need for real-time analytics across industries, expanding use of digital twins and industrial simulations, and increasing adoption of heterogeneous computing architectures. Major trends in the forecast period include technology advancements in graphics processing units (GPUs) and accelerator architectures, innovations in parallel programming frameworks, developments in cloud-native high-performance computing (HPC) platforms, research and development in quantum-parallel hybrid computing, and advancements in distributed computing and edge-integrated parallel processing.

What Is The Driver Of The Parallel Computing Market?

The increasing adoption of cloud computing is expected to propel the growth of the parallel computing market going forward. Cloud computing refers to the delivery of computing resources such as servers, storage, databases, networking, software, and analytics over the internet to offer faster innovation, flexible resources, and economies of scale. The adoption of cloud computing is driven by scalability, as they allow businesses to easily adjust computing resources based on demand and reduce infrastructure costs. Parallel computing enhances cloud computing by enabling simultaneous processing of large datasets across multiple processors. It improves computational speed, scalability, and efficiency of cloud-based applications and services. For instance, in December 2023, according to Eurostat, a Luxembourg-based government organization, 45.2% of enterprises across the European Union purchased cloud computing services, with 77.6% of large enterprises, 59% of medium-sized enterprises, and 41.7% of small businesses adopting cloud services. Therefore, the increasing adoption of cloud computing is driving the growth of the parallel computing industry.

What Are Latest Mergers And Acquisitions In The Parallel Computing Market?

In July 2025, Synopsys Inc., a US-based software company, acquired Ansys Inc. for an undisclosed amount. With this acquisition, Synopsys strengthened its portfolio of high-performance simulation and verification tools, expanded its capabilities in parallel and high-performance computing for chip design, and enhanced end-to-end solutions for semiconductor and electronics manufacturers. Ansys Inc. is a US-based engineering simulation software company providing high-performance and parallel computing solutions.

How is Market Value Defined and Measured?

The market value is defined as the revenues that enterprises gain from the sale of goods and/or services within the specified market and geography through sales, grants, or donations in terms of the currency (in USD unless otherwise specified). The revenues for a specified geography are consumption values that are revenues generated by organizations in the specified geography within the market, irrespective of where they are produced. It does not include revenues from resales along the supply chain, either further along the supply chain or as part of other products.
